The iPhone 14, released in September 2022, and the iPhone 16, launched in September 2024, represent different generations within Apple's smartphone lineup. While both devices offer a consistent user experience through Apple's iOS ecosystem, the iPhone 16 introduces notable advancements in processing power, camera capabilities, and connectivity. These differences cater to varying user needs and priorities, making a detailed comparison valuable for those considering an upgrade or a quality-assured refurbished option.

The iPhone 14 and iPhone 16 both offer compelling smartphone experiences, each suited to different user priorities. The iPhone 14, released in 2022, is frequently praised by users for its reliable performance, excellent camera capabilities, and solid battery life, even several years after its launch. Many find it continues to be a great choice for everyday use, offering a balanced set of features that meet the needs of most consumers.
The iPhone 16, introduced in 2024, builds upon its predecessors with significant enhancements. Users often highlight its substantially improved processing power, which makes demanding applications and multitasking feel exceptionally fluid. The upgraded camera system, particularly its low-light performance and higher megapixel count, receives positive feedback for capturing detailed photos and videos. The transition to a USB-C port and the addition of the customizable Action Button are also frequently cited as practical improvements that enhance convenience and usability. Some users upgrading from older models express satisfaction with the overall performance and battery life.
Users prioritizing a device with the latest performance capabilities, enhanced camera features, and modern connectivity standards like Wi-Fi 7 and USB-C will find the iPhone 16 well-suited to their needs. Its extended software support timeline also appeals to those seeking a longer-term investment. Conversely, users who value a proven and reliable device that still delivers strong performance for daily tasks, and who may not require the absolute latest technological advancements, may find the iPhone 14 to be a practical choice.
